Date: Thu, 24 Nov 2016 10:25:12 +0000 From: Mark Rutland <mark.rutland@....com> To: linux-kernel@...r.kernel.org Cc: dave@...olabs.net, dbueso@...e.de, dvyukov@...gle.com, jasowang@...hat.com, kvm@...r.kernel.org, mark.rutland@....com, mst@...hat.com, netdev@...r.kernel.org, paulmck@...ux.vnet.ibm.com, virtualization@...ts.linux-foundation.org Subject: [PATCH 1/3] tools/virtio: fix READ_ONCE() The virtio tools implementation of READ_ONCE() has a single parameter called 'var', but erroneously refers to 'val' for its cast, and thus won't work unless there's a variable of the correct type that happens to be called 'var'. Fix this with s/var/val/, making READ_ONCE() work as expected regardless.
